Congratulations on the interview. As others have said, you can fly directly from Canada to California - your POE will be at the airport prior to boarding the plane. The reasons some have driven a number of hours to a land border is often because they want to obtain an employment stamp when they enter the US and some land POEs still issue it, but none of the airport POE's do.
